Low-Pressure Pumps
A low-pressure pump is the heart of any soft washing system. These pumps are designed to provide a gentle flow of water, typically between 40 and 80 PSI, which is significantly lower than the pressures used in traditional pressure washing. Low-pressure pumps are essential for soft washing, as they allow you to clean delicate surfaces without causing damage. When choosing a low-pressure pump, consider the flow rate, which is typically measured in gallons per minute (GPM). A higher flow rate will allow you to clean larger areas more quickly, but may also increase the risk of oversaturating the surface.
Pump Types
There are several types of low-pressure pumps available, each with its own unique characteristics and advantages. Diaphragm pumps and centrifugal pumps are two of the most common types used in soft washing. Diaphragm pumps are known for their high flow rates and ability to handle thick, viscous cleaning solutions. Centrifugal pumps, on the other hand, are more compact and lightweight, making them ideal for smaller soft washing systems.
Specialized Nozzles and Spray Tips
Specialized nozzles and spray tips are designed to work in conjunction with low-pressure pumps to apply cleaning solutions safely and effectively. These nozzles are typically wider than those used in traditional pressure washing, which allows for a more even distribution of the cleaning solution. Soft washing nozzles are designed to provide a wide fan pattern, which helps to prevent streaks and oversaturation. When choosing a nozzle or spray tip, consider the size of the area you’ll be cleaning, as well as the type of surface being cleaned.
Soft Washing Solutions
Soft washing solutions are a critical component of any soft washing system. These solutions are designed to loosen and remove dirt, grime, and other substances from surfaces, without damaging the surface itself. Soft washing solutions typically contain a combination of surfactants, bleaching agents, and other additives that help to break down and remove tough stains. When choosing a soft washing solution, consider the type of surface being cleaned, as well as the level of staining or discoloration.
Solution Concentration
The concentration of the soft washing solution is critical to achieving the best results. A solution that is too concentrated can damage the surface being cleaned, while a solution that is too diluted may not effectively remove stains and discoloration. Most soft washing solutions are designed to be mixed with water at a specific ratio, typically between 1:1 and 1:10. Be sure to follow the manufacturer’s instructions for mixing and applying the solution.
Additional Equipment and Accessories
In addition to low-pressure pumps, specialized nozzles, and soft washing solutions, there are several other pieces of equipment and accessories that can be useful for soft washing. Hoses, reels, and spray wands can help to make the soft washing process more efficient and convenient. Hoses with a built-in filter can help to prevent debris and particulate matter from entering the pump and damaging the equipment. Reels can be used to store and manage hoses, keeping them organized and out of the way. Spray wands can be used to apply cleaning solutions to hard-to-reach areas, such as gutters and downspouts.
Tank and Container Options
A tank or container is necessary for storing and mixing soft washing solutions. Tanks and containers should be made of a durable, chemical-resistant material, such as polyethylene or stainless steel. Consider the size of the tank or container, as well as the type of lid or closure. A tank with a wide mouth and a secure lid can make it easier to mix and apply soft washing solutions.
Safety Equipment
Safety equipment, such as gloves, goggles, and a respirator, is essential for protecting yourself from the chemicals and cleaning solutions used in soft washing. Always follow the manufacturer’s instructions for safety precautions and take necessary steps to protect yourself and others in the surrounding area. Consider the type of safety equipment needed, as well as the level of protection required. A respirator with a HEPA filter can provide excellent protection against airborne particles and chemicals.

What is soft washing and how does it differ from traditional power washing?
Soft washing is a cleaning method that uses a combination of low-pressure water and specialized cleaning solutions to gently remove dirt, grime, and other substances from surfaces. This approach differs significantly from traditional power washing, which relies on high-pressure water jets to blast away dirt and debris. Soft washing is a more gentle and controlled method, making it ideal for delicate surfaces such as roofs, siding, and stucco, where high-pressure washing could cause damage.
The key benefit of soft washing is its ability to effectively clean surfaces without causing damage or disruption. By using a low-pressure approach, soft washing minimizes the risk of stripping away protective coatings, damaging surfaces, or displacing granules from roofs. Additionally, soft washing solutions are typically designed to be environmentally friendly and safe for use around plants, pets, and people. This makes soft washing a popular choice for homeowners, property managers, and cleaning professionals who need to clean sensitive surfaces without compromising their integrity or safety.
